History of Partnership: Columbia Theological Seminary (CTS) has long enjoyed a rich and meaningful student and faculty exchange relationship with the Protestant Theological Faculty of Charles University.
Most
recently, Drs. Anna Carter Florence and Brennan Breed led the
course and took thirteen CTS students to Prague. On
January 8, Dr. Florence attended the meeting of
the American Working Group. There she spoke about the student visit to Prague, explained the history
and purpose of such visits, and of how the visits broaden the
horizons of students who often have very little knowledge of the
world or the church beyond the south-eastern United States.
For the 2004-2005 academic year, Dr. Petr Sláma of the Protestant Theological Faculty of Charles University was a Fulbright Scholar at CTS. And for most years since 1989, CTS has hosted a Charles University student for a semester of study on scholarship. During fall term 2018, Charles University will host two CTS students to study on exchange.
We are very grateful for this vibrant relationship and the important learning and understanding it promotes.
